Job summary

Scorpion Therapeutics is seeking a Production Engineer to provide technical assessment and support for small-molecule API manufacturing, with emphasis on process knowledge, equipment support, optimization, asset management, and engineering systems.

You will perform risk assessments, learn reactor design and automation, ensure safety and regulatory compliance, and contribute to scale-up modeling and experimental work in a fast-paced biotech setting.

Qualifications

  • BS or MS in Chemical Engineering (or related engineering).
  • Minimum 2 years’ experience in pharmaceutical/biotech/chemical manufacturing or related batch manufacturing.
  • Authorized to work in the US full-time; no visa sponsorship.

Responsibilities

  • Provide technical assessment and support for production operations for developing/sustaining process knowledge, process & equipment support, process optimization, equipment capability & asset management, and engineering business systems for small-molecule API manufacturing.
  • Perform impact and risk assessments for unit operations.
  • Learn lab/plant reactor design, including automation recipes and procedures.
  • Ensure safety for people and environment and follow company safety policies.
  • Ensure processing equipment complies with internal Quality System requirements, applicable engineering standards, and cGMP requirements.
  • Assess rig fit by reviewing technical data packages for new processes and performing modeling/simulations and/or experimental work for scale-up (heat/mass transfer).
  • Communicate with HSE, Quality Assurance, Tech Services, Development, Operations, FUME/C&Q, Automation, Maintenance, Environmental Monitoring, and Manufacturing.
  • Author/review/approve technical reports and regulatory submissions; maintain records/technical notebooks.
  • Proactively identify quality issues and apply a quality approach.
  • Develop/review project plans and timetables.
